Fair Debt Collection Practices Act
A federal law that limits the behavior and actions of third-party debt collectors attempting to collect debts on behalf of another person or entity.
Debt Collector
An individual or company that collects debts owed by consumers, often on behalf of a creditor.
Civil Penalty
A financial penalty imposed by a government agency as punishment for violating a civil law or regulation, distinct from criminal penalties.
Cease-and-Desist Order
A legal order issued by a government authority or court directing a person or entity to stop an illegal or questionable activity immediately.
